Emjoy Pricing Analysis
Emjoy is freemium as of March 2026. Free access gets you a limited but real sample of audio sessions - enough to decide if the format works for you. The premium plan is $9.99 per month with no annual billing option currently listed. Worth paying? Yes, if audio-guided solo intimacy content is what you're actually looking for - Emjoy is one of the few apps that does this specifically for women without layering in generic meditation fluff.
The free tier on Emjoy includes a handful of introductory audio sessions covering arousal, self-exploration, and body awareness - not just teasers, but full short-form content pieces. Premium at $9.99/month opens the complete session library, which covers topics from orgasm training to erotic audio stories to confidence exercises, totaling hundreds of individual tracks. There's no annual plan listed as of March 2026 - which is a real gap compared to Coral ($9.99/mo, couples-focused) and O.school ($9.99/mo, education-forward). No token system, no tipping, no hidden costs. Emjoy charges $9.99/month and that's the entire price structure.
Honestly, the three main sex-ed audio apps - Emjoy, Coral, and O.school - are all sitting at $9.99/month, which makes comparison more about content focus than price. Emjoy wins on solo female pleasure content specifically; Coral wins on couples work; O.school wins on educational depth and live coaching. Quick note: Emjoy's free trial length varies by platform. iOS users sometimes see 7-day trials; Android users report shorter windows. Start on whatever platform gives you the longer trial before committing to a monthly subscription.
